Episode Synopsis

The Galapagos Islands are some of the most incredible, but fragile, ecosystems in the world. Isolated for millions of years, the 1800s saw the introduction of goats, leading to extreme devastation. To combat this, in 1997, the ambitions Project Isabela was conceived. And the goal was simple - eradicate 140,000 goats on three separate islands.
